המנדט הנשיאותי הנוכחי

Abdel Fattah el Sisi, having served as President of Egypt since 2014, is currently slated to hold office until 2030. This extended tenure was formally established by a significant 2019 constitutional amendment. This amendment notably lengthened presidential terms from four to six years and specifically permitted President Sisi to serve through the current period, by allowing for a reset of his term count. The changes effectively made him eligible to serve two more six year terms after his 2018 2024 term, thereby solidifying his constitutional pathway to remain in power until 2030. This constitutional revision anchored his term end date firmly in the national constitution, providing a clear and legally defined timeline for his current mandate and the foreseeable future of his leadership.
